Lady Layton release date confirmed for autumn 2017

Layton’s Mystery Journey: Katrielle will launch for Nintendo 3DS, iOS and Android later this year, Level 5 has confirmed.

Formerly known as Lady Layton: The Millionaire Ariadone’s Conspiracy, the upcoming puzzler is set to launch in its homeland of Japan on July 20 for both mobile platforms and 3DS.

International players can download the iOS and Android versions on the same day, although they’ll have to wait for a port to Nintendo’s platform.


“Formerly titled Lady Layton: The Millionaire Ariadne’s Conspiracy, this new installment of the Professor Layton series is a strategic mystery puzzle solving game that follows Katrielle Layton, who searches for her missing father Professor Hershel Layton,” Level 5’s description reads.

“The new title is an exciting departure from previous games in the Professor Layton series as it is made up of a combination of smaller conundrums and puzzles that need to be solved in order to complete the overall mystery. This new format is going to appeal to existing Layton fans as well as attract a brand new audience.”

Since its debut in 2007 for the original DS the beloved puzzle series has sold over 16 million units worldwide with a multitude of great entries.
